Pocket watch type saboneta of three covers. 19th Century.
Silver box with three lids, richly decorated with engravings in guilloché technique and floral motifs, with central cartouche without engraving. The inside of the back lid bears engraved inscriptions with the mark "R. P. Aet Genève", the indication of 7+ rubies in the movement and the serial number 9685.3.
White porcelain enameled dial with Roman numerals for the hours and Arabic for the minutes, with spade hands and subsidiary seconds at six o'clock. Pearled bezel and fluted crown with suspension ring.
Hand-wound mechanical movement, with mainplate decorated with zigzag Côtes de Genève finish and openworked bridges. The escapement system and gear train show a typical manufacture of late 19th century Swiss watchmaking. It works.
Weight: 124 g.
Measurements: 5.4 cm (case diameter).
